May a tenant subject to a lease with a remaining term less than 35 years avoid reassessment when the property is sold?
Equinix LLC v. County of Los Angeles Facts: A buyer acquires commercial real estate subject to a lease with a remaining term of less than 35 years. The tenant is responsible for payment of property taxes due during the lease. The county assessor reassesses the property on the transfer of ownership, resulting in an increase […]
